Finally checking out my amp. Using Ty's checkout regimen I obtained figures that left me questioning. V10 pin 3 was 9.886 ohms, pin 7 was 74.6, and pin 8 was 9.86. The power tube sockets both pin 5s were230.3, both pins 1 and 8 were 10.2. Is all okay and go ahead plug 're in, or does something warrant looking at? Thank you.
..... V10 pin 3 was 9.886 ohms, .... and pin 8 was 9.86. ....
May or may not be a problem. Cathodes of the dual triode. There is an electrolytic capacitor bypassing the resistor. They have to be allowed to charge. It would read low while it is charging. After they have charged, it should be 220 ohms.
pin 7 was 74.6,
Grid of the triode. Should be 220K. Do you have a volume control installed?
The power tube sockets both pin 5s were230.3, ....
Control grids of the power tubes. Do you by chance have an autoranging voltmeter? 220K is normal. 220 is off by a factor of 1000.
..... both pins 1 and 8 were 10.2.
May or may not be a problem. Cathodes of the power tubes. There is an electrolytic capacitor bypassing the cathode resistors. They have to be allowed to charge. It would read low while it is charging. After they have charged, it should be whatever your cathode resistance is.
Is all okay and go ahead plug 're in, or does something warrant looking at? Thank you.
The pin 7 isn't right. I would re measure the others letting those caps charge, and make sure you have 220K resistors on the grids of the power tubes, and not 220 ohm resistors. You may have misread the color bands and swapped some resistors - it's easy to do, and we've all done it at one time or another.
